The second Forbes Asia 100 to Watch list, released on 30 August 2022, acknowledges 100 small companies and startups across the Asia-Pacific region that have changed the game by providing solutions and innovations from their products and services. As the region shifts and opens its operations into the post-pandemic setting, we can see that creativity, resiliency, and capacity for change are the top qualities of the companies on the list.

Fifteen countries and territories are represented across 11 categories that came from biotechnology and healthcare, e-commerce, retail, and finance. Singapore’s startup community contributed 19 companies to the list and Hong Kong with 16 representatives.

Forbes Asia’s editorial team selected the companies by soliciting online submissions and inviting accelerators, incubators, SME advocacy organizations, universities, venture capitalists, and others for nominations. Submissions were evaluated from the following metrics: a positive impact on the region or industry, strong revenue growth or a high chance for funding, promising business models or markets, and a persuasive story. There were a total of 650 submissions.
